Over the past years, the US FDA has approved many fluoropolymers, e.g., PTFE, PFA, and FEP, for use in repeated food contact. In addition, these fluoropolymers also serve as excellent alternatives to exotic metals at high temperatures in applications like chemical processing, oil wells, motor vehicle engines, and nuclear reactors, where hydrocarbon-based polymer presents dysfunctionality.
“The fluoropolymer family is famed for low toxicity and almost no toxicological activity. Few fluoropolymers have been reported to cause skin sensitivity and irritation in humans,” said the Marketing Chief of Alfa Chemistry. “Meanwhile, fluoropolymers are also known for many other properties, such as chemical resistance, thermal stability, flame resistance, low friction coefficient, low surface energy, low dielectric constant, as well as high volume and surface resistivity.”
Among the fluoropolymer family, PTFE is the dominant one and is closely followed by FEP, PFA, ETFE, and other tetrafluoroethylene-copolymers. Meanwhile, the mentioned fluoropolymers account for about 3/4 of the entire fluoropolymer market. It is worth mentioning that fluoroelastomers have also received growing popularity in the recent decade as highly specialized and functional materials.
